Place your snacks on the board in order from largest to smallest. Start with any bowls or dishes for snacks (like olives and hummus) and space them out on the board so you can place smaller snacks in between. Then fill in the extra space with "loose" snacks, like veggies and crackers.

Cut the top off the bell pepper and deseed the inside. Fill your prepared dip inside the cavity of the pepper then place onto the board. Fill the hummus into small bowls and space them out onto your board. Place the vegetables around the dips and fill in any holes with cherry tomatoes.

A charcuterie board is a selection of foods usually served on a wooden board. The term charcuterie board is derived from the french word charcuterie which means cold cooked or preserved meats. Traditional charcuterie boards are usually filled with cured meat, cheese, preserved veggies, and fruits. The recipe below is a vegetarian charcuterie.

1 bowl: place it in the center of the board or drastically on one end. 2 bowls: place them together in the center or on opposite sides. 3 bowls: place them in a triangle across the board. 4+ bowls: place them in an S shape across the board you're using. Next, add other larger components.
